What can I see and do near California African American Museum?
You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at California Science Center, Natural History Museum of Los Angeles County or Grammy Museum. Sights like Eastern Columbia Building, Broadway Theater District and The Bloc are must-sees while exploring the area. You can watch performances at Peacock Theater, Orpheum Theatre and Palace Theater if you're interested in local theatre.
